I've read (and read!) that you shouldn't store objects in Session variables.
I've read these reasons:
- The object takes up memory that may not be freed until the session times
out. Better to create the object only when you actually use it.
- Causes poor performance because the thread that created the object has to
service all requests for it.
Assuming I can live with the memory and performance implications (a big if,
but let's assume it for a minute), what other reasons are there?

The reasons against this diminish as server power grows - obviously if you
have a really hefty server, you can handle the memory usage issues. THe
threading issue is fairly easily overcome by making sure you only use free
threaded objects (such as MSXML.FreeThreadedDomDocument).
It can get to be a bit of a chore to manage them too, and debugging can be
tricky, but if you think you can handle that, along with the memory
requirements, then feel free. Just make sure you have an idea of how much
memory you're going to end up using.

By doing this, you've prevented the use of OLE DB session pooling, and, if
you haven't changed the threading model of ADO from apartment to
free-threaded (which you should not do if using Jet), you've serialized all
of your database access.
Just because you cannot perceive a performance issue does not mean one does
not exist.

The best suggestion I have is the one that comes from Microsoft: take advantage of session pooling by instantiating and opening connections on each page, closing them as soon as you are finished using them. Only the first opening of a connection will take time. Once the connection is in the pool, subsequent uses will not require the same time to open them.

Yes, in IIS, session pooling is on by default (which can be confirmed by
reading the material in the links I provided). However, there are coding
practices that will cause it to be disabled. A quick perusal of your code
does not reveal any of the practices i was thinking of.

PS. Have you at least changed the threading model of your ADO objects by
using the makfre15.bat batch file which can be found in your ADO folder? If
you are not using Jet, you really should do this. Most of my objections to
caching the object in session go away if you change the treading model.
what about the Server.CreateObject? i always thought object creation and instantiation would add heavy overhead... and thus negatively affect performance
In earlier versions of IIS, it was always recommended that you get MTS
involved by using Server.CreateObject. In later versions (5.1 and higher, I
think) the reasons for encouraging the use of server.createobject have been
resolved. Performance can be improved by using the vbscript version of
CreateObject (simply leave out the "Server.")

Interesting. I do not see it on one of our W2003 servers either. Several
possibilities come to mind:
1. It's no longer necessary to do this change in W2003
2. They don't want you doing this change in W2003
3. You can't make this change in W2003
I'm not sure which is the correct reason.
All the batch file does is run the registry merge file called ADOFRE15.REG
(contained in the same folder) that contains these registry keys:
REGEDIT4
[HKEY_LOCAL_MACHINE\SOFTWARE\Classes\CLSID\{0000050 7-0000-0010-8000-00AA006D2EA4}\InprocServer32]
"ThreadingModel"="Both"
[HKEY_LOCAL_MACHINE\SOFTWARE\Classes\CLSID\{0000051 4-0000-0010-8000-00AA006D2EA4}\InprocServer32]
"ThreadingModel"="Both"
[HKEY_LOCAL_MACHINE\SOFTWARE\Classes\CLSID\{0000050 B-0000-0010-8000-00AA006D2EA4}\InprocServer32]
"ThreadingModel"="Both"
[HKEY_LOCAL_MACHINE\SOFTWARE\Classes\CLSID\{0000053 5-0000-0010-8000-00AA006D2EA4}\InprocServer32]
"ThreadingModel"="Both"
[HKEY_LOCAL_MACHINE\SOFTWARE\Classes\CLSID\{0000054 1-0000-0010-8000-00AA006D2EA4}\InprocServer32]
"ThreadingModel"="Both"

ok, here's the deal:
it really is faster to use the existing adodb pooling. while allocating /
connecting the ADODB.Connection object costs quite some time, the advantage
of not having ~300 sleeping connections to the db server overweights this.
and using CreateObject instead of Server.CreateObject improves object
allocation time as well.
and last but not least: not having to deal with pooling myself makes the
code slicker and nicer.
while my system was faster for an iis4/asp2 setup on w2k (where initial
tests where made some years ago), it is defenitely not faster anymore on
iis6/asp3/w2k3.
thanks for doubting my initial postings. while storing objects in
session/application does not seem to be any problem, having a multitude of
open connections to the sql server really is.
